Zotero Standalone: "An error has occurred"

Hello - When I open up Zotero Standalone, I'm getting the following message.

"An error has occurred. Please restart Zotero."

I've tried restarting several times, and checked my sync log-in details etc. but no change. Any ideas please?

    These are some odd errors.

    We don't normally recommend this, but start by uninstalling Zotero (your data won't be affected) and reinstall it from the download page.

    If that doesn't help, close Zotero, go to your Zotero profile directory, and move prefs.js to your desktop. Then start Zotero and see if the problem is fixed. If it is, email that old prefs.js file on your desktop to support@zotero.org with a link to this thread so that we can figure out what happened here. (You can then delete it.) If not, we'll need to debug this further.
  • Thank you so much, our IT department have reinstalled and the problem seems to have gone away.
